An Amazon Games identification is a unique, persistent identifier used within the Amazon Games ecosystem. This identifier allows players to be recognized across various Amazon Games titles and services. For example, a players achievements in one Amazon Games title can be linked to this ID, potentially unlocking benefits or rewards in another.

The utility of this identification lies in its ability to unify player experience. It streamlines the process of connecting with friends, tracking progress, and accessing cross-game promotions. The Amazon Games identification facilitates a unified and personalized gaming experience. Adhering to specific guidelines can enhance its utility and security.

Tip 1: Employ Robust Password Practices: Create a strong, unique password for the Amazon Games account. A comb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ols enhances security. Avoid reusing passwords across multiple platforms to minimize vulnerability.

Tip 2: Enable Two-Factor Authentication: Implement two-factor authentication to add an extra layer of protection. This measure requires a verification code from a separate device or application in addition to the password, mitigating the risk of unauthorized access.

Tip 3: Regularly Review Account Activity: Periodically examine account activity logs for any suspicious or unrecognized login attempts. Promptly report any anomalies to Amazon Games customer support for investigation.

Tip 4: Manage Linked Accounts Judiciously: Exercise caution when linking external accounts to the Amazon Games identification. Only connect accounts from trusted sources and regularly review linked accounts to ensure continued relevance and security.

Tip 5: Stay Informed About Amazon Games Security Updates: Keep abreast of security updates and announcements from Amazon Games. Apply any recommended patches or security enhancements promptly to maintain the integrity of the account.

Tip 6: Understand Data Privacy Settings: Familiarize yourself with the data privacy settings associated with the Amazon Games identification. Adjust these settings to align with personal preferences regarding data sharing and targeted marketing.

Tip 7: Report Suspicious Communications: Be wary of phishing attempts or unsolicited communications requesting account information. Verify the legitimacy of any communication claiming to be from Amazon Games before providing sensitive details.
